Great drinks. Great food. Great location. Scratch that. We should have led with location, because that’s the real selling point of the 'Point. Formerly the Point, the pub (we use the term loosely as the venue comes equipped with a couple of cocktail bars too) sits just up the road from Blackwattle Bay and makes the most of it with a killer verandah. Inside, there’s an impressive bistro serving the likes of minty pumpkin risotto with goat's cheese and slow-cooked beef cheeks on parsnip mash. The wine and cocktail menus are equally impressive, and White Rabbit and Pipsqueak make for interesting tap offerings for those that want to opt for beer. Head to one of the hotel’s four bars and get started with a classic Caprioska to sip on the balcony. When the temperature drops, head for the open fireplace and crack a bottle of Pirathon Shiraz. This is our hands-down pick of the Pyrmont pubs.
